Is Actress Shruti Haasan Turning Into A Scriptwriter?

New Delhi: Kamal Haasan’s daughter, Shruti Haasan has hit films like D-Day, Ramaiya Vastavaiya, Srimanthudu, Balupu and Yevadu in her kitty. Multi-talented like her father, Shruti is also an avid writer who has expressed her desire to turn stories into scripts.

This is not the first time that Shruti Hassan has expressed her love for writing. She had previously told IANS, “Writing has always been a liberating process for me. I have been writing songs, poetry or at times just my feelings down, and I believe it can help you express yourself so much better. I have been writing poetry and stories I would love to develop into fullfledged scripts and I’m currently working on this. With all the hectic schedule, writing helps me unwind and its extremely therapeutic for me. Song writing is another aspect I thoroughly enjoy, and I have been constantly sharpening my skills over the years.”

Shruti has done songwriting in the past. With her passion for storytelling, fans are eagerly waiting to see what she has in store as a writer. In her statement, Shruti said, “I have always been drawn to the art of storytelling and I’m excited to explore my writing skills. It’s been a dream of mine to write scripts that connect with the audience and I’m looking forward to this new journey,” News18 reported.

The actress has not yet shared any details about her upcoming projects or what genre of scripts she plans to write.

On the professional front, Shruti Haasan will be seen in ‘Salaar.’ It will be the first time Prabhas and KGF director Prashanth Neel work together. She was most recently seen in Waltair Veerayya, a movie starring Chiranjeevi that has been hailed as a box office hit. Along with Salaar, she is working on an international project called The Eye, a dark psychological thriller with a 1980s setting, the Greek-British production. The actress will also feature in an international film titled The Eye which will centre around a young widow who travels back to the island where her husband died, to spread his ashes. But what awaits her is something unexpected. The Daphne Schmon’s psychological thriller will also feature actor Mark Rowley of The Last Kingdom, the report added.
